Dr Nicole Mennell appointed Director of Service & Impact

Dr Nicole Mennell has been appointed Director of Service & Impact at King’s College London.

Nicole will work across faculties and directorates to strengthen the university’s commitment to serving the needs of society and creating meaningful impact, ensuring this mission is embedded in King’s education, research, and business operations.

A member of the King’s community since 2019, Nicole brings extensive experience in strategic development and programme delivery. Most recently, she was the professional services lead for King’s Sanctuary Programme, which creates opportunities for people whose lives have been disrupted by forced displacement.

Through working in partnership with colleagues across the university, Nicole oversaw the expansion of the programme, including the growth of our Sanctuary Scholarships and Fellowships, and the development of the University Sponsorship Model. This model provides displaced students and academics with a safe route to the UK and the support needed to rebuild their lives.

In her new role, Nicole will lead a portfolio of programmes within the International, Engagement & Service Directorate that brings together staff, students and community partners to strengthen King’s response to urgent and enduring global challenges. These initiatives include King’s Sanctuary Programme, King’s Volunteering, and One King’s Impact.
